They tend to be lighter and absorb quickly, so you can still apply makeup, or double up with your favorite eye cream, afterward. While eye creams are great for hydrating the delicate eye area, serums provide a concentrated amount of key ingredients to target specific concerns like crow's feet, puffiness, and dark circles.
